Transaction ec7ef6196ffb316d08821c63c83aaff03681d585552eac5eebb4dc017883d4d0
1 Input
2 Outputs
- ec7ef6196ffb316d08821c63c83aaff03681d585552eac5eebb4dc017883d4d0:0
- ec7ef6196ffb316d08821c63c83aaff03681d585552eac5eebb4dc017883d4d0:1
value 22027600
address 19EvWJu7LwAxsQzJK5XfDZNt7ZWdvJTUNG
value 372314196
address 15VAUyjgSWYEqSwm3KzuwQpBvHCN17xi7B